Window installation services typically cover a range of tasks aimed at upgrading or replacing existing windows to enhance a property’s comfort, appearance, and functionality. This process often involves removing old or damaged windows, preparing the opening for the new units, and installing a variety of window styles such as double-hung, casement, or picture windows. Many service providers also include options for upgrading to more energy-efficient models, ensuring better insulation and reduced utility costs. Proper installation is key to maximizing the benefits of new windows, and local contractors are equipped to handle the different types of window systems and installation techniques suited to the specific needs of each property.

Spring Checklist

Before comparing options, clearly describe your window installation project to help local contractors recommend the best solutions.

  • Check window measurements to ensure proper fit and functionality. - Accurate measurements are essential for a seamless installation and energy efficiency.
  • Evaluate the condition of existing window openings for any structural issues or damage. - Proper assessment helps determine if repairs are needed before new window installation.
  • Consider the style and material of windows that complement the home's design and climate needs. - Selecting the right windows enhances curb appeal and performance during spring weather.
  • Review the quality and durability of the window frames and glass options available from local contractors. - High-quality materials can improve longevity and insulation.
  • Ensure that weatherproofing and sealing are addressed to prevent leaks and drafts. - Proper sealing is vital for maintaining indoor comfort and energy efficiency.
  • Discuss installation techniques and standards with local service providers to ensure a professional setup. - Proper installation ensures the windows function correctly and last longer.

How To Compare Local Pros

When evaluating local contractors for window installation during the spring season, it’s helpful to consider their experience with similar projects. Homeowners should inquire about how many window installations the service providers have completed, particularly those involving comparable styles, materials, or architectural features. An experienced contractor will typically have a deeper understanding of the specific challenges that can arise with springtime projects, such as fluctuating weather conditions or coordinating with other seasonal home improvements. This background can contribute to a smoother process and help ensure the work aligns with the homeowner’s expectations.

Clarity in the scope of work is essential when comparing local service providers. Homeowners are encouraged to seek detailed descriptions of what each contractor’s window installation includes, such as removal of old windows, framing adjustments, insulation, and finishing touches. A well-defined scope helps prevent misunderstandings and provides a clear basis for evaluating the professionalism and thoroughness of each contractor. It also enables homeowners to identify any potential gaps or additional services that might be needed to complete the project to their satisfaction.

Work planning considerations are particularly relevant during the spring, when weather conditions can influence the installation process. Homeowners should ask service providers how they plan to manage scheduling around variable spring weather and how they prepare for unexpected delays. Additionally, understanding how contractors coordinate with other ongoing home projects or seasonal maintenance can provide insight into their organization and reliability. A contractor’s approach to planning can impact the overall success of the window installation, ensuring the project progresses smoothly and efficiently.
